Transaction 3b63014e3221f1c1633ca9a6908e7f58b58fc7d85e5c3cddf18999fc23b328e9
2 Input
2 Outputs
- 3b63014e3221f1c1633ca9a6908e7f58b58fc7d85e5c3cddf18999fc23b328e9:0
- 3b63014e3221f1c1633ca9a6908e7f58b58fc7d85e5c3cddf18999fc23b328e9:1
value 4792987
address 3BeAVvMUfCxpdJjBfmooSify8cpzyzwtdJ
value 16755217
address 1PqPzDLbQgJV4xp9EM75dtQsNt9qTHir3p